Respironics, Inc. Trilogy 100 Ventilators: Class I Recall - Device May Stop Delivering Therapy to Patient

Summary:

FDA notified health care professionals of the Class 1 recall of this product due to a manufacturing issue can stop delivering therapy to the patient. Part of the blower that circulates air and other gases through the ventilator may move out of position and cause the device to alarm.  Failure to respond could result in the potential for harm or death of a ventilator-dependent patient.

Bedford Laboratories Vecuronium Bromide And Polymyxin B For Injection USP For Injection: Recall - Glass Particles

Summary:

Bedford Laboratories issued guidance on the nationwide voluntary product recalls originally issued on August 2, 2011. The recalls were initiated after the discovery of a visible glass particle in a limited number of vials within the lots listed.

ASA Submits Comments to CMS Regarding Transition to Version 5010 and ICD-10

Chicago — (October 15, 2008) 

ASA has submitted comments to the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) regarding the transition to version 5010 and ICD-10. A rushed implantation of these new systems would create administrative and technical burdens for physicians and practice managers.

Version 5010

The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) has proposed that version 5010 allow only the reporting of minutes for anesthesia time, rather than anesthesia units. If implemented, this policy would result in significant disruptions for providers who must submit claims to Medicare using anesthesia units, but must use minutes when submitting claims to private payers.

ICD-10

ASA acknowledges that a transition to ICD-10 will offer many benefits and enhancements to health care reporting and tracking. However, the short timeframe proposed by CMS will place enormous burdens on a system that already faces tremendous challenges.

Founded in 1905, the American Society of Anesthesiologists is an educational, research and scientific association with 46,000 members organized to raise and maintain the standards of the medical practice of anesthesiology and improve the care of the patient.
